Coq 8.7集成了流行的Ssreflect库。因此可以通过以下方式导入其库:
From Coq Require Import ssreflect ssrfun ssrbool.
但是,当我尝试导入ssrnat
时,它会抱怨它是Unable to locate library ssrnat with prefix Coq
,我也无法在磁盘上的Coq发行版中找到ssrnat。故意将ssrnat
故意不包括在内,或者将文件夹放入另一个模块,或者我的安装是否有问题?
答案 0 :(得分:4)
ssrnat
未包含在主Coq发行版中,但有一天我们希望提供扩展发行版,默认情况下可以使用更多库。
在Coq 8.7中,仅包括战术语言本身ssreflect
以及一些基本支持库ssrfun ssrbool
。
我们没有包含更多内容的原因是因为ssrnat
使用了数学 - 数学等级,因此这是一个更具侵略性的"变化
幸运的是,由于包含了插件,安装ssrnat是一项非常简单的任务。